CAS 32161-30-1
:3-Methoxy-O-methyl-L-tyrosine
Description:
3-Methoxy-O-methyl-L-tyrosine, also known by its CAS number 32161-30-1, is a derivative of the amino acid tyrosine, characterized by the presence of methoxy and O-methyl functional groups. This compound typically exhibits a white to off-white crystalline appearance and is soluble in polar solvents, which is common for many amino acid derivatives. Its molecular structure includes a phenolic hydroxyl group, which contributes to its potential biological activity, including antioxidant properties. The methoxy and O-methyl substitutions can influence its reactivity and interaction with biological systems, making it of interest in biochemical research. Additionally, this compound may play a role in various metabolic pathways and could be studied for its potential therapeutic applications.
